4 points for Danny Abdia in Washington's dramatic loss to New York
The Israeli also dropped 7 rebounds and gave up 2 assists, but the Wizards dropped a 19-point lead in Madison Square Garden and surrendered 115: 113 to the Knicks on the buzzer

Danny Abdia played tonight (Friday-Saturday) his third and final preseason game ahead of the official opening of the 2021/22 season in the NBA, when his Washington Wizards suffered a dramatic loss to the New York Knicks at Madison Square Garden.
The Israeli's team surrendered 115: 113 on the buzzer following a decisive basket by Julius Randall, after already leading by 19 points during the game.
Abdia had 23 minutes in which he did not stand out, and finished the evening with 4 points, 7 rebounds and 2 assists, scoring with one shot out of four from both the field and the penalty line.
The Wizards were left without a win in the preseason, while New York recorded a perfect balance.
